DetailsSulfide ores such as chalcopyrite ((CuFeS_2)) are converted to copper by a different method from silicate, carbonate or sulfate ores. Chalcopyrite (also known as copper pyrites) and similar sulfide ores are the commonest ores of copper. The ores typically contain low percentages of copper and have to be concentrated before refining …

DetailsThe Chemical of Africa (CHEMAF) is a hydrometallurgical plant operated in Katanga since 2001. It produces copper metal using a process comprising the sulphuric acid leaching of copper-cobalt oxide ores under reducing conditions (Na 2 S 2 O 5 or SO 2 ) followed by the leach liquor purification by solvent extraction (SX) and electrowinning of copper.

DetailsExtraction of copper from ore begins with pre-treatment. Due to the decreasing concentration of copper in ores, this is an important step to decrease the volume of material and to increase the grade of copper in the ore. Most copper ores will only contain a small percentage of copper mineral, with the average grade being below 0.6% copper.
